Common Mild Side Effects

Temporary Redness

Some individuals may experience slight redness immediately after treatment, especially those with sensitive skin. This usually fades within a few hours.

Skin Tightness or Sensitivity

  • Mild tightness may occur after exfoliation
  • Skin may feel more sensitive for a short time
  • This typically resolves quickly

Light Breakouts (Rare)

In some cases, skin may purge impurities, leading to minor breakouts that are temporary and part of the cleansing process.

Rare Side Effects

Irritation in Very Sensitive Skin

Although uncommon, highly sensitive skin may react mildly to exfoliation or serum ingredients.

Over-Exfoliation Effects

If done too frequently or incorrectly, the skin barrier may feel slightly compromised, leading to dryness or irritation.

Allergic Reactions (Very Rare)

Some individuals may react to specific serums used during treatment, but this is uncommon due to customizable formulations.

What Causes Side Effects?

Skin Type Sensitivity

People with extremely reactive or compromised skin barriers are more likely to notice temporary effects.

Incorrect Aftercare

  • Using harsh skincare products too soon
  • Skipping sunscreen
  • Not following hydration routine

Overuse of Treatment

Frequent sessions without proper spacing may increase sensitivity in some individuals.

How to Minimize Side Effects

Follow Professional Guidance

  • Choose trained skincare specialists
  • Ensure proper skin assessment before treatment
  • Use customized serums based on skin type

Proper Aftercare Routine

  • Avoid makeup for a few hours
  • Use gentle cleansers and moisturizers
  • Apply sunscreen daily
  • Stay well hydrated

Maintain Correct Treatment Frequency

Most people benefit from sessions every 3 to 4 weeks rather than frequent repetition.

Who Should Be More Careful?

Sensitive Skin Individuals

Extra caution is recommended for those with very reactive or allergy-prone skin.

People with Active Skin Conditions

  • Severe eczema or psoriasis
  • Open wounds or infections
  • Strong skin inflammation

A professional consultation is important before proceeding in such cases.

When to Contact a Specialist

Unusual Reactions

  • Persistent redness beyond 24–48 hours
  • Strong irritation or burning sensation
  • Unusual swelling or discomfort

These cases are rare but should be checked by a skincare professional if they occur.
